SOWETO - One person has died and two have been injured after e-hailing vehicles were torched outside Maponya Mall in Pimville, Soweto on Wednesday night.

The incident has been linked to a long-standing feud between e-hailing drivers and local taxi operators.

According to Colonel Dimakatso Nevhuhulwi of the Saps, unknown suspects are said to have approached the driver of an e-hailing vehicle and shot him before setting the car alight.

"An ehailing vehicle was seen stopping at the entrance when about four men approached the driver and shot at him before torching the vehicle. Another vehicle which was nearby was shot at and the driver managed to flee and his vehicle was also torched. It was later discovered that the driver and another passerby sustain gun shot wounds and were taken to hospital." 

The tensions come just weeks after e-hailing operators demonstrated in Gauteng over working conditions and disputes over profit-sharing with e-hailing companies.

A case of murder, two counts of attempted murder and arson has been opened for further investigation. The SAPS and JMPD are on the scene to monitor the situation.
